Background of TikTok
Before diving into the details of TikTok’s shopping platform, it’s essential to understand its background. TikTok 18 originated in China in 2016 and gained international recognition when it merged with the app Musical.ly in 2018. Since then, it has experienced explosive growth and has become a cultural phenomenon, particularly among Gen Z users.

TikTok’s US Shopping Platform
TikTok’s US Shopping Platform aims to provide a seamless shopping experience within the app, allowing users to discover and purchase products directly from their favorite content creators and brands. The platform will offer a range of features and functionalities designed to enhance the shopping experience and drive conversions.
Features and Functionality
The shopping platform will incorporate features like product catalogs, in-app checkout, and integrated shopping carts, streamlining the entire purchasing process. Users will have access to curated collections, personalized recommendations, and the ability to explore products through hashtags and trending content.

Regulatory and Privacy Issues
TikTok 18 has faced scrutiny over data privacy and security concerns, with some governments expressing apprehension about the potential for user data being accessed by foreign entities.
